Q:
How many prizes are there
in every draw?
A:
2,363 ticket numbers are drawn at random, one after another. These numbers (in drawn order) win prizes from the First Prize of $100,000 down to $5. But there are still 4,726 more prizes to be won! Every ticket holder who has a ticket number that is closest to any of the winning numbers drawn, will receive a consolation prize. The closest ticket number sold may not be the next consecutive ticket number. That means a total of 7,089 tickets win in every $2 Casket draw.

Gold Lotto is the original
Lotto game in Queensland. Saturday Gold Lotto is Queensland's
most popular game and has been making dreams come true
since 1981. Wednesday Gold Lotto was introduced in May
1996 and gives players a mid-week chance to win Gold Lotto.
Q:
Does Wednesday Gold Lotto
guarantee a First Division prize?
A:
Wednesday Gold Lotto guarantees
$1 million each for up to four First Division winners
each week. If there are one, two, three or four First Division
winners, they will each receive $1 million. If there are
more than four winners, they will then share in a prize
pool of $4 million.

Q:
What are Gold Lotto Superdraws
and Megadraws?
A:
On a number of special occasions throughout the year, Gold Lotto offers an extraordinarily large First Division prize. These special events are called Superdraws and Megadraws. In the past, First Division prizes for Superdraws have ranged from $18 million to $25 million. On 31 December 2005, an even bigger First Division prize was offered, when the $32 million Megadraw was drawn.

Oz 7 Lotto is a national lottery
game offering players the chance to Live Life. The game was launched as Oz Lotto in 1994, and is played on Tuesday
nights. Oz Lotto was changed to Oz 7 Lotto for the first Oz 7 Lotto draw on October 18, 2005. Oz 7 Lotto has 7 numbers, with 7 prize divisions. More information on playing Oz 7 Lotto can be found in the Oz 7 Lotto 'How to Play' page within this website.
